
Napoli came into the encounter, brimming with confidence and sitting comfortably at the top, 18 points ahead of the closest challengers Inter Milan, who incidentally are the only other team to have beaten Luciano Spalleti's men this season.
The early exchanges were lively, with both teams going at each other. After a goalless first half, Mathias Vecino broke the deadlock in the 67th minute, and the closest effort Napoli had to level scores was a Victor Osimhen header that hit the woodwork.
Lazio moved into second place temporarily, level on points with third place Inter Milan who have a game in hand.
